Use cases for Panta Germ microbiome analysis
Panta Germ is used in a wide variety of aquatic systems, from living room aquariums to professional aquaculture. Here you can see in which application areas a microbiome analysis provides particularly valuable additional information.
Aquarium
From nano tanks to large aquariums: With Panta Germ, you can check how stable the microbiome is in the system, whether the water and biofilm communities are compatible, and whether recurring problems with algae, cloudiness, or failures could have a microbial cause.
Aquaculture
In intensively managed systems, a stable microbiome is crucial for growth, feed conversion, and animal health. The analysis helps to specifically monitor stress peaks, feed changes, or system conversions and to identify risks early on.
Koi Pond
High stocking densities, ample feeding, and strong seasonal changes place particular stress on koi ponds. A microbiome analysis shows whether filter and pond biology can keep up—and supports you in optimizing filter technology, maintenance, and stocking.
Swimming Pond
In swimming ponds, bathing, plant zones, and technical treatment meet. Panta Germ helps to check whether the microbiome harmonizes in the different areas and whether undesirable developments are emerging.
Garden Pond
Garden ponds are highly dependent on seasons, external inputs, and changing maintenance. The microbiome analysis shows how these influences affect the bacterial community—and where starting points for better stability arise.
Pond Farming
In extensive and intensive pond farming, microbial processes in the water and sediment play a central role. With Panta Germ, management steps, stocking strategies, or feed changes can be microbiologically monitored.
Natural Water
Rivers, lakes, or near-natural retention basins have complex microbiomes that react to nutrient inputs, use, and hydrology. Panta Germ supports the documentation of stresses, the monitoring of renaturation measures, or the definition of reference states.

How You Can Use Panta Germ in Your Applications
In practice, many users start with one or a few tanks or ponds to get a feel for the informative value of the microbiome data. Subsequently, further areas are specifically included—such as problem tanks, neuralgic points in the system or particularly valuable stocks.
For larger projects, measurement series can be planned in which samples are taken over the season, along management steps or before and after concrete measures. This creates a picture that goes far beyond a snapshot and shows how your system really “ticks.”
